Eternal Image Group Debuts Line of Caskets Licensed by the Vatican Observatory Foundation[TM]

The Eternal Image Group LLC., (the “Company”), a licensing company active in the memorial products industry, today unveiled its line of caskets officially licensed by the Vatican Observatory Foundation[TM].  The caskets join memorial prayer cards of the same brand already offered by the Company.  Product details and links to photo galleries can be viewed here: www.brandmemorials.com/vatican-observatory-foundation/.

“At a time when we mourn the loss of a loved one from earthly life, these sacred images can remind us of the promise we have in Christ’s Resurrection,” said Father Timothy Babcock, the Archdiocese of Detroit’s Clergy Liaison for Funeral and Cemetery Services, who was given a preview of the caskets. “It is fitting at the time of death for Catholics to look upon our hope in Christ and the intercession of the Blessed Mother for strength and consolation.”

The caskets are available in either solid mahogany or solid hardwood and each includes a keepsake sash for the family. Adorning the interior is an exclusive piece of Renaissance-style Catholic artwork of which there are ten selections, including three exclusive Latino-style pieces by artist Vincent Barzoni.

“We recently sold our two millionth Vatican Observatory Foundation prayer card,” said Nick Popravsky, VP of Sales for the Company.  “They’re used in funeral services all across the country.  This will remain one of the most sought after global brands for decades to come.”

The caskets are distributed by Buchanan Private Label of Indianapolis, Indiana and can now be delivered to any funeral home in the United States. Kaczorowski Funeral Home of suburban Baltimore, Maryland, was the first to order a Vatican Observatory Foundation casket.

About Vincent Barzoni

For nearly half a century, New York born Vincent Barzoni has been at the forefront of the design and art world. He has lived in Connecticut for more than 40 years.  After private study with noted sculptors James Earl Fraser and Berthold Nebel as well as muralist Barry Faulkner, Mr. Barzoni was ready to make his mark.  Winning the coveted Hall of Fame of the Trotters award for equestrian sculpture he quickly became an internationally acclaimed sports sculptor. His mechanical and artistic design work has won him commissions from Abercrombie & Fitch, F.A.O. Schwartz, and the Audubon Society among others.  Barzoni’s excellent work in pastels and watercolors has found enormous acceptance. His work spans a wide range of subjects and his religious works are widely admired. He has become one of the most reproduced artists in the world.
